Permisions
Hi, I was wondering if there was anything I could do about this little problem.
I have server admin rights, yet I can't change anything in the permisions as the "AdminSetServerPermissions" box is un-ticked, and I can't tick it, as because its un-ticked, I dont have the right permissions to tick it =/
This means I can't change any other permissions nor do anything about it at the mo.
Is there anything I can do to sort this, or will I have to get in touch with my TS host?
Thanks.
-
18-07-2006, 14:32 #2Bastian Guest
You have to get in touch with your TS host.
